2. Sun Protection

Sun protection is a critical factor in managing the appearance of forehead veins. Ultraviolet (UV) radiation from the sun can significantly impact skin structure and vascular integrity, influencing the visibility of veins.

  • Collagen Degradation

    Prolonged sun exposure causes collagen breakdown in the skin. Collagen provides structural support, maintaining skin thickness and elasticity. UV radiation accelerates the degradation of collagen fibers, leading to thinner skin. As the skin thins, underlying structures, including veins, become more visible. Protecting the skin from UV radiation helps preserve collagen, maintaining skin thickness and reducing the prominence of forehead veins. For instance, individuals with a history of frequent sunbathing often exhibit increased vein visibility due to collagen loss.

  • Weakened Blood Vessel Walls

    UV radiation can weaken the walls of blood vessels. Chronic sun exposure damages the endothelial cells lining blood vessels, compromising their structural integrity. This damage can lead to vascular dilation and increased fragility. Weakened blood vessel walls are more prone to becoming prominent and visible through the skin. Consistent sun protection helps maintain the integrity of blood vessel walls, reducing the likelihood of dilation and prominence. Consider individuals who work outdoors without sun protection; they often experience accelerated vascular damage.

  • Increased Skin Inflammation

    Sun exposure triggers inflammation in the skin. UV radiation induces an inflammatory response, characterized by redness and irritation. Chronic inflammation can exacerbate existing vascular conditions and contribute to the dilation of blood vessels. This dilation makes veins more visible. Protecting the skin from the sun minimizes inflammatory responses, reducing the dilation of blood vessels and decreasing the appearance of forehead veins. For example, avoiding sunburn is crucial in preventing inflammation-induced vein prominence.

  • Exacerbation of Existing Vascular Conditions

    Sun exposure can worsen pre-existing vascular conditions. Individuals with underlying vascular issues, such as telangiectasias (spider veins), may find that sun exposure intensifies these conditions. UV radiation promotes the formation of new blood vessels (angiogenesis) and exacerbates existing vascular abnormalities. Protecting the skin from the sun is vital for preventing the aggravation of vascular conditions and limiting the visibility of forehead veins. Patients with rosacea, for instance, often experience flare-ups with sun exposure, leading to increased vein prominence.

The consistent application of sun protection measures, including sunscreen use, wearing protective clothing, and seeking shade during peak UV radiation hours, is essential for maintaining skin health and minimizing the appearance of forehead veins. By mitigating collagen degradation, strengthening blood vessel walls, reducing skin inflammation, and preventing the exacerbation of vascular conditions, sun protection plays a pivotal role in diminishing the visibility of these veins. 6. Avoid Straining

The act of straining, whether during physical exertion or bowel movements, increases intra-abdominal and intra-thoracic pressure. This pressure surge translates to elevated venous pressure throughout the body, including the superficial veins of the forehead. When an individual strains, blood flow is momentarily impeded, leading to distension of the veins as blood accumulates. Over time, repeated straining can contribute to the permanent dilation of these veins, rendering them more visible. Therefore, avoiding activities that induce significant physical straining becomes a crucial component of strategies aimed at minimizing the prominence of forehead veins.

Practical applications of this principle involve modifying lifestyle habits to reduce instances of straining. For example, individuals engaged in heavy lifting should employ proper techniques, such as maintaining correct posture and exhaling during exertion, to mitigate pressure buildup. Similarly, those experiencing chronic constipation should address the underlying cause through dietary adjustments and hydration, rather than relying on excessive straining during bowel movements. Medical conditions that provoke chronic coughing or vomiting should also be managed proactively to minimize repetitive elevations in venous pressure. Moreover, activities like holding one’s breath during exercise, which can transiently raise intrathoracic pressure, should be avoided or modified.

In summary, avoiding straining is a critical consideration within a holistic approach to managing visible forehead veins. By reducing the frequency and intensity of pressure surges on the venous system, individuals can potentially prevent further dilation and prominence of these veins. Addressing underlying causes of straining and adopting appropriate compensatory techniques contributes to a more sustainable strategy for aesthetic improvement and vascular health. 9. Temperature Control

Temperature control is a relevant factor in addressing the appearance of forehead veins due to its direct influence on blood vessel dilation. Elevated temperatures, whether environmental or resulting from activities such as intense exercise, cause blood vessels to expand, increasing blood flow to the skin surface for heat dissipation. This vasodilation makes superficial veins more prominent and visible. Conversely, exposure to cold temperatures causes vasoconstriction, reducing blood flow and diminishing the visibility of veins. Therefore, managing temperature exposure is a practical consideration for individuals seeking to minimize the appearance of forehead veins. For instance, spending prolonged periods in hot environments or engaging in activities that significantly raise body temperature without adequate cooling measures can exacerbate vein prominence.

Practical application of temperature control involves several strategies. Avoiding prolonged exposure to direct sunlight and hot environments is crucial. When exposure is unavoidable, the use of cooling towels, fans, or air conditioning can help maintain a lower body temperature and minimize vasodilation. Similarly, during and after physical activity, cooling down gradually and staying hydrated can prevent excessive vein dilation. Conversely, while cold temperatures can temporarily reduce vein visibility, prolonged exposure to extreme cold should be avoided, as it can lead to other circulatory problems. The goal is to maintain a stable, moderate temperature range to minimize fluctuations in blood vessel diameter. Consider an individual who regularly uses a cold compress on their forehead after exercising; they may experience a temporary reduction in vein visibility due to vasoconstriction.

Question 1: Can forehead veins be completely eliminated through natural methods?

Complete elimination of forehead veins solely through natural methods is generally not achievable. While lifestyle modifications and topical treatments can improve skin health and reduce vein prominence, they are unlikely to eliminate veins entirely. Natural approaches focus on mitigating factors that contribute to vein visibility and promoting overall vascular health.

Question 2: How long does it take to see results from natural methods targeting forehead veins?

The timeline for observing noticeable changes varies depending on individual factors such as skin type, vein size, and consistency in adhering to the recommended strategies. Improvements are typically gradual, often requiring several weeks or months of consistent effort. Patience and adherence to a comprehensive approach are essential for achieving optimal results.

Question 3: Are there specific foods that should be avoided to reduce forehead vein prominence?

While no single food directly causes forehead veins, certain dietary habits can exacerbate their appearance. High sodium intake, processed foods, and excessive alcohol consumption can contribute to increased blood pressure and inflammation, potentially making veins more visible. Limiting these substances and focusing on a balanced diet rich in antioxidants and fiber is advisable.

Question 4: Can stress directly impact the visibility of forehead veins?

Yes, chronic stress can indirectly influence the visibility of forehead veins. Stress triggers the release of cortisol, which can elevate blood pressure and weaken blood vessel walls over time. Managing stress through relaxation techniques, regular exercise, and adequate sleep can contribute to overall vascular health and potentially reduce vein prominence.

Question 5: Are topical treatments, such as vitamin K cream, effective for reducing forehead veins?

Topical treatments like vitamin K cream may offer some benefit in improving skin health and reducing bruising, which can indirectly improve the appearance of superficial veins. However, scientific evidence supporting their direct effectiveness in reducing vein size is limited. Consistent application and realistic expectations are important when using these products.
